I Recently received this knife in an interesting group of knives from an estate sale.

No idea who the maker is. The only reference that i can find to "MAGIC" in the GOINS' ENCYCLOPEDIA of CUTLERY MARKINGS says it is a trademark used by THE EAGLE PENCIL COMPANY.

i have been told that the "MAGIC" from the EAGLE PENCIL COMPANY does not refer to this knife.

Any help with identifying this knife will be appreciated.

Solid well constructed vintage knife. Strong snap closing. tapered blade. Wood scales.
